About Ján Lang
Ján Lang is a scholar working on Applied Mathematics, Mathematical Physics, Numerical Analysis, Computational Theory and Mathematics and Statistics and Probability, having authored 74 papers that have together received 696 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Harmonic Analysis Research (26 papers), Differential Equations and Boundary Problems (14 papers), Nonlinear Partial Differential Equations (14 papers), Advanced Banach Space Theory (14 papers), Holomorphic and Operator Theory (14 papers), Advanced Mathematical Modeling in Engineering (11 papers), Mathematical Approximation and Integration (8 papers) and Approximation Theory and Sequence Spaces (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Mathematics (413 citations), Numerical Analysis (103 citations), Mathematical Physics (155 citations), Computational Theory and Mathematics (190 citations) and Management Information Systems (75 citations). Ján Lang has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Czechia. Frequent co-authors include D. E. Edmunds, D. E. Edmunds, Aleš Nekvinda, Osvaldo Méndez, Petr Gurka, Zuo‐Jun Max Shen, Wolfgang Domschke, D.J. Harris, Ján Janík and Ron Kerman.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Approximation Theory, Journal of Mathematical Analysis and Applications, Journal of Functional Analysis, Mathematische Nachrichten and Proceedings of the Royal Society A Mathematical Physical and Engineering Sciences.
